Some children have symptoms from birth.  The harder to diagnose (late onset) Autistic Symptoms usually begin around 18 months or by age three.  They may include any or all of the following and may begin as mild symptoms, but gradually worsen with time:

Several parents I have talked to agreed that the first signs were lack of eye contact and loss of words.  See also senses.

 

The Autism Research Institute (ARI) has developed a Diagnostic Checklist (Form E-2).  The responses on Form E-2 are entered into a computer which calculates a diagnostic score. The score is sent to the person or agency submitting the checklist.  This is a free and confidential service.  It is done for free to assist researchers with standardizing and improving the diagnosing of autistic children.
